[0029] A method for filtering a voltage signal according to an embodiment of the present invention includes the following steps:
[0030] The analog-to-digital converter samples the voltage signal to be filtered, and measures the peak-to-peak value Vpp of the noise of the voltage signal;
[0031] The analog-to-digital converter sends the digitized voltage signal and the measured noise peak-to-peak value Vpp to the microprocessor;
[0032] The microprocessor calculates the voltage change threshold Vt according to the measured noise peak-to-peak value Vpp, Vt=N*Vpp, 1.5≤N≤2;
[0033] The microprocessor compares the voltage value of the digitized voltage signal with the voltage change threshold Vt, and if the voltage value of the digitized voltage signal is less than the voltage change threshold Vt, the digitized voltage signal at the current moment is processed by a Kalman digital filter.
